「windows系统如何离线安装nessus漏洞扫描工具」:零网络环境下也能轻松部署的专业指南
在网络安全日益重要的今天,Nessus作为全球领先的漏洞扫描工具,被众多企业和安全专家所青睐🔍。但很多用户面临一个问题:如何在无网络环境下,特别是Windows系统中离线安装Nessus?今天我就为大家带来一份详尽的解决方案,让你即使在没有互联网连接的情况下,也能顺利完成Nessus的安装与配置💡。
为什么需要离线安装Nessus?
在某些特殊环境下,比如企业内网、保密单位或网络受限区域,在线安装Nessus几乎不可能实现❌。这时离线安装就成为了唯一选择。此外,离线安装还能避免因网络问题导致的中断,确保安装过程的稳定性与完整性✅。
常见需要离线安装的场景包括:
– 企业内部网络安全检测
– 政府或军队保密网络环境
– 网络受限的开发测试环境
– 无外网连接的服务器部署
准备工作:离线安装Nessus必备材料清单
在开始安装之前,我们需要准备以下关键材料📋:
1. Nessus离线安装包
- 从Tenable官方网站下载对应Windows版本的Nessus离线安装包
- 目前最新稳定版本为Nessus 9.x系列(请根据需求选择家庭版或专业版)
- 文件大小通常在1GB左右,确保有足够的存储空间💾
2. 激活码/许可证文件
- 注册Tenable账户获取免费的家庭版许可证
- 或购买商业版许可证获取激活码
- 许可证文件通常以.lic为后缀名📄
3. 离线插件包(可选但推荐)
- 下载最新的插件离线包,确保漏洞数据库的完整性
- 插件包大小可能在500MB-1GB之间,视版本而定🔧
详细安装步骤:手把手教你完成Windows离线安装
第一步:下载离线安装包(有网络环境时准备)
虽然我们最终要在无网络环境下安装,但第一步的下载工作必须在有网络的环境中完成🌐。
- 访问Tenable官方网站(https://www.tenable.com/downloads/nessus)
- 选择”Windows”平台
- 选择”Offline Installer”选项
- 登录或创建Tenable账户
- 下载对应版本的离线安装包和插件包
💡 个人建议:选择与目标机器相同系统架构的版本(32位或64位),避免兼容性问题
第二步:传输文件到目标Windows系统
将下载好的安装包通过U盘、移动硬盘或内部网络传输到目标Windows机器上🔌。
传输注意事项:
– 确保文件完整性(可对比MD5值)
– 建议使用压缩包形式传输,节省空间并减少传输错误
– 传输完成后,先验证文件是否完好无损
第三步:开始离线安装过程
现在进入最关键的安装环节!按照以下步骤操作:
- 双击运行安装程序(通常为Nessus-*.exe)
- 选择安装类型:自定义安装或典型安装(推荐典型安装)
- 接受许可协议:仔细阅读并接受Tenable的使用条款
- 选择安装路径:默认路径通常为C:\Program Files\Tenable\Nessus
- 等待安装完成:此过程可能需要5-10分钟,取决于系统性能
⚠️ 重要提示:安装过程中不要关闭安装窗口或断电,否则可能导致安装失败
第四步:激活Nessus漏洞扫描工具
安装完成后,需要进行激活才能正常使用🔑:
- 打开浏览器,访问:https://localhost:8834/
- 首次访问会提示设置管理员账户和密码
- 创建账户后,系统会生成一个激活码
- 使用Tenable账户获取激活文件:
- 登录Tenable账户
- 进入”我的Nessus”页面
- 选择”激活码”或上传许可证文件
- 下载激活文件(nessus.license)
- 将激活文件传输到目标机器并放置到Nessus配置目录
🎯 激活成功标志:能够正常登录Nessus web界面,并看到完整的漏洞扫描功能
常见问题与解决方案
Q1: 安装过程中出现依赖组件缺失错误怎么办?
解决方案:Windows系统可能需要安装Visual C++ Redistributable等依赖组件,可从微软官网下载对应版本的运行库🔧。
Q2: 激活后无法访问web界面?
排查步骤:
– 检查防火墙设置,确保8834端口开放
– 确认Nessus服务已启动(可在服务管理中查看)
– 尝试使用不同浏览器访问
Q3: 插件更新失败?
离线解决方案:在有网络的环境中下载最新插件包,然后手动导入到离线系统中📥。
专业建议与独家见解
根据我多年为企业部署Nessus的经验,离线安装虽然复杂,但安全性更高🛡️。特别是在处理敏感数据或保密项目时,离线环境能有效降低信息泄露风险。
几点专业建议分享:
1. 定期更新插件:即使离线环境,也要建立定期更新机制(通过内部网络或物理介质)
2. 备份配置:定期导出Nessus配置和扫描结果,防止数据丢失
3. 权限管理:严格控制Nessus管理账户的访问权限
4. 网络隔离:建议将运行Nessus的机器放置在隔离网络中,仅允许必要的通信
📊 数据显示:正确配置的Nessus能够在企业环境中发现85%以上的常见漏洞,是网络安全防护的重要一环
通过以上步骤,相信你已经掌握了Windows系统离线安装Nessus漏洞扫描工具的核心技术🔧。无论是在受限网络环境还是出于安全考虑,这种方法都能让你顺利部署这一强大的安全工具。
记住,安全扫描只是第一步,持续监控和及时修复才是保障网络安全的关键⚡。希望这篇教程对你有所帮助!